#2028b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2028b4 is composed of 12.5% red, 15.7%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 77.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 236.8 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 41.6%. #2028b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#4050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2028b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2028b4 has RGB values of R:32, G:40,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 2107572.

Shades and Tints of #2028b4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030d is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2028b4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#69696b is the less saturated color, while #0812cc is the most saturated one.
